The Collaborative International Dictionary of English (GCIDE) v.0.53
blitz

n. 1. (football) a quick move by defensive players toward the passer on the offensive team, as soon as the ball is snapped; -- it is used when the defensive teams assumes that a pass will be attempted, and risks allowing substantial gains by the offensive team if other plays are in fact planned.
Syn. -- safety linebacker blitzing. [ WordNet 1.5 +PJC ]

2. a rapid and violent military attack with intensive aerial bombardment. Same as blitzkrieg [ WordNet 1.5 ]

3. any vigorous and intensive attack, bombardment, or assault, literally or figuratively; as, they used a blitz of television commercials to launch their new product; the German blitz on London. [ WordNet 1.5 +PJC ]

3. same as blitz chess. [ PJC ]

blitzkrieg

n. [ German, blitz lightning + krieg war. ] an overwhelming all-out attack with infantry, armor, and air forces, especially by surprise against an unprepared enemy. [ PJC ]
